Debra Dwyer (Foley)

Joe Borden was an extraordinarily sweet man. He only attended Blanchet freshman and sophomore years, then finished at Lincoln, as did many of his close friends from St Benedict's (a group of boys often known as the Benny's Boys).

Those of you who attended Christ the King may remember Chris Murphy. She and Joe were quite the item freshman year!

I understand Joe's career included construction, shipyards, Seattle Center, Goodwill Games, affordable housing, even work with the Archdiocese. Although occasionally a 'trouble-maker' in his youth, he grew to be something of a Renaissance Man.

He was married for 18 years and had three daughters as well as three grandchildren.

In the summer of 2016, several months before he passed away (on October 19 2016), Joe organized a "reunion" of sorts, inviting his friends from St Benedict's to his home on Capital Hill overlooking Lake Union. He knew he'd be dying soon, but he still looked really good and chose not to tell anyone about his cancer. We (I attended as a date of my favorite Benny's Boy) enjoyed a tremendous turnout, wonderful food, and everyone seemed to have a great time. He didn't want anyone to feel sad; he wanted to leave his friends happy.
